Uvanella

Source Data
SourceIDLink
Global Biodiversity Information Facility ID (GBIF)4580857https://www.gbif.org/species/4580857
PaleoBioDB ID (PBDB)3838https://paleobiodb.org/classic/checkTaxonInfo?taxon_no=3838
Rankgenus
Taxonomy (GBIF)Life : Animalia : Porifera : Hexactinellida : Celyphiidae : Uvanella
Taxonomy (PBDB)Life : Animalia : Porifera : Demospongea : Hadromerida : Celyphiidae : Uvanella
Taxonomic Status (GBIF)accepted
Classification
(PBDB,GBIF)
RankNameAuthor
-Eukaryota
-OpisthokontaCavalier-Smith 1987
kingdomAnimalia
phylumPoriferaGrant 1836
classDemospongea
subclassTetractinomorphaLévi 1956
orderHadromeridaTopsent 1898
familyCelyphiidaeLaubenfels 1955
genusUvanellaOtt 1967
Scientific NameUvanella Ott, 1967
Name Published InAbh. Bayer. Akad. Wiss. (N. F.) 131
Opinions (PBDB)
NameRankOpinionEvidenceAuthor
Uvanellagenusbelongs to Cystothalamiidaestated with evidenceBoiko et al., 1991
Uvanellagenusbelongs to Calcareasecond handSepkoski, 2002
Uvanellagenusbelongs to Celyphiidaestated with evidenceFinks et al., 2004
Status (PBDB)extinct
Taxon Size (PBDB)7
First Recorded Appearance272 - 269 Ma
Permian
Last Recorded Appearance209 - 201 Ma
Mesozoic
Environmentmarine (based on Hadromerida)
Motilitystationary, attached (based on Hadromerida)
Dietsuspension feeder (based on Hadromerida)
Taphonomyaragonite (based on Hadromerida)
Primary Reference (PBDB)E. V. Boiko, G. V. Belyaeva, and I. T. Zhuravleva. 1991. Sphinktozoa Phanerozoya Territorii SSSR [Phanerozoic Sphinctozoa of the Territory of the USSR]
